What Are Exoskeletons?
Exoskeletons are wearable devices that support and enhance the user's physical capabilities. Often resembling robotic suits, they assist in movement, helping people with mobility issues such as those caused by stroke, spinal cord injuries, and other conditions. These devices are designed to mimic, support, or enhance the natural movements of the body, providing strength and stability to those who may need it.
While technology may seem futuristic, the World Health Organization recognizes the potential benefits these devices hold, particularly for the aging population. Exoskeletons are becoming increasingly sophisticated, with advancements in materials, sensors, and control systems that allow for more natural and intuitive movement.
Exoskeletons vs. Bionics
It's important to distinguish between exoskeletons and bionics. While both involve wearable technology, the key difference is in integration. Exoskeletons are external and assist with movements through mechanical support. In contrast, bionics integrate electronics with biological functions, often involving more invasive procedures. Bionics may include devices like prosthetic limbs that are controlled by neural signals, offering a closer integration with the body's natural functions.
The distinction is crucial for understanding what might be suitable for individual needs. While exoskeletons focus on external support, bionics aim to replace or enhance biological functions. This difference impacts not only the technology used but also the potential applications and suitability for different users.
Types of Exoskeletons
There is a variety of exoskeletons designed to meet different needs:
- Powered Exoskeletons: These use electric motors, pneumatics, or hydraulics to augment the user's strength and endurance. They're common for both military and medical uses. Powered exoskeletons are often used in rehabilitation settings to assist with walking and other movements.
- Passive Exoskeletons: Relying on mechanical structures to distribute weight, these do not use power but support users through springs and dampers. Passive exoskeletons are often used in industrial settings to reduce strain on workers.
- Soft Exosuits: Unlike rigid exoskeletons, these are lightweight and flexible, often used for rehabilitation and assistance in daily tasks. Soft exosuits are designed to be worn like clothing, providing subtle assistance to muscles and joints.
Each type of exoskeleton has its own advantages and limitations, and the choice of which to use will depend on the specific needs and conditions of the user.
How Exoskeletons Can Help Seniors
For seniors, the benefits of exoskeletons include improved mobility, reduced fall risk, and increased independence. According to recent studies, using exoskeletons can enhance physical activity levels, which is crucial for maintaining health and well-being in older age. These devices can provide the necessary support to help seniors engage in daily activities that might otherwise be challenging.
Exoskeletons can aid in physical therapy, providing support and resistance exactly where needed, thus enhancing rehabilitation outcomes. They can be used to assist with walking, standing, and other movements, helping to rebuild strength and coordination after injuries or surgeries.
Beyond physical benefits, exoskeletons can also have psychological benefits. By enabling greater independence and mobility, they can improve confidence and reduce feelings of isolation or dependence on others.
Medicare Coverage for Exoskeletons
While the concept of exoskeletons is exciting, understanding whether they are covered by Medicare is essential for seniors looking to explore this technology.
Current Status of Coverage
As of now, Medicare does not broadly cover exoskeletons. These devices are considered investigational and therefore not included under standard benefits. However, coverage might be possible under certain conditions, like clinical trials or if classified as durable medical equipment specific for rehabilitation.
Medicare's current stance reflects the ongoing evaluation of exoskeleton technology's effectiveness and cost-efficiency. As research continues and more data becomes available, the policies regarding coverage may evolve.
Eligibility Criteria
When coverage is possible, eligibility criteria often include:
- Proof of medical necessity, often requiring documentation from healthcare providers. This documentation must clearly demonstrate how the exoskeleton will benefit the individual's health and mobility.
- Participation in Medicare-approved clinical trials. These trials are essential for gathering data on the effectiveness and safety of exoskeletons.
- Specific diagnoses that might qualify for experimental therapy options. Conditions such as spinal cord injuries or severe mobility impairments may be considered.
Staying informed about potential changes in policy, especially with CMS announcements, is advised. Seniors and their families should regularly check for updates on Medicare's coverage policies to ensure they have the most current information.
Cost and Alternatives
Given the limited coverage, understanding the potential costs and available alternatives is important.
Out-of-Pocket Costs
Exoskeletons can be expensive, with prices ranging from $40,000 to over $100,000 depending on features and capabilities. This makes financing options crucial for those considering purchase. Some manufacturers may offer payment plans or financial assistance programs to help make these devices more accessible.
Rental Options
Some suppliers offer rental options, which can be more economical for temporary needs. Exploring both purchase and rental through Medicare’s list of approved suppliers is recommended. Rentals may be particularly useful for those who need exoskeletons for short-term rehabilitation or trial purposes.
Alternative Mobility Aids
For those unable to afford an exoskeleton, traditional mobility aids such as walkers, canes, or wheelchairs may still provide valuable support. While they may not offer the same level of assistance as an exoskeleton, they are often more affordable and widely covered by Medicare.

What Are the Maintenance Requirements for Exoskeletons?
Maintenance requirements for exoskeletons vary by model and manufacturer. Generally, they require regular cleaning and inspection to ensure they function correctly. Some models may need software updates or battery replacements. It's important to follow the manufacturer's maintenance guidelines to keep the device in optimal condition.
